I don't mean to tell a man how to do is business, but if you're not happy with your miles /schedule, speak up and let your DM know. Tell him you want a restart every week if that's what you are wanting, that isn't too much to ask. If need be just burn your 70 and force the issue. It may very well be if you'd run that way that long they might just think you are happy with it and this is the schedule you wantcdavis188, MidWest_MacDaddy, runningman0661 and 1 other person Thank this.

Exactly. If I can get myself into some kind of a rhythm, where I can run 4-6hrs at a stretch, I usually burn my drive time up and still have an hour or more on my 14. If I stop short, it's usually because I am trying to time my passage through Chicago or some other time suck. I would rather have a short day than risk getting caught up in that #### show near Gary, IN. By the end of the week, I am usually in a position where I get my 34 in before I get anything useful from recap. (Or I get recap hours at midnight, but all 70 at 0100) I tend to drive either overnight, or start around 0200-0300.
